Scott, age 45, formerly of Kerman, Ca. died on Friday, June 10, 2011, in Cusseta, Ga. after an ATV accident.
He is survived by his wife Angela and her children Jerome, Alexandria, and Ashanti; Scott´s sons, Michael and Jonathan; Scott's daughter, Ashley; his mother, Verna Reyes and her husband Bob; his father, Alton Powell and his wife Karen; and his brother, Mike Powell.
A Memorial Service will be held at Northwest Church, Barstow and West on Saturday, July 9, 2011, at 10:00 a.m. He was buried at Ft. Benning, Ga.
Remembrances may be made to Valley Teen Ranch, 2610 W. Shaw Ln., Ste. 105, Fresno, Ca. 93711.
